Marlow Continues to Push Limits with New Morfrac Block Technology

Marlow Ropes are pleased to be working with new block manufacturer Morfrac Systems 

created and engineered by G Yacht Design based in Valencia Spain.

This new hardware has been developed with the latest innovative technology using Morfrac’s patented AGB (Adaptive Geometry Bearing) system and required a high performing professional rope solution that aligned with their brand principles of quality, reliability and technical craftsmanship.

Using Marlow’s range of Dyneema® D12 SK78, D12 SK99, Chafe Covers and Whipping Twine has enabled Morfrac to take their customised light and durable block hardware to the next level; creating high load blocks that work forall sailors from amateur to professional whether they are racing or cruising.  

The technically advanced systems are now used across 

·     TP52: Alegre (2018), Onda (2018), Bronenosec (2019) .

·     Class 40: Veedol, Leyton. 

·     Mini 650: series and protos.

·     Dinghy: Optimist, Star, Snipe, Nacra 17.

·     Soft Wing Sails by Advanced Wing Systems. (www.advancedwingsystems.com)
